Ticket: Config drift on BounceHarbor prod

During the pre-release audit for the 4.2 train, I compared the running configuration of the BounceHarbor email bounce processor against what's committed in the Fernvale config repo, and they no longer match. Retry windows and suppression-list thresholds were changed manually sometime after the last deploy, which means the next release will silently revert them. Before we cut 4.2, we need a decision on which set wins. For reference, the values currently live in production are as follows.

config for bahop-fajep:
DRUATH_PIN=4501
DRUATH_TENANT=briwyn
DRUATH_METRICS_HOST=metrics.druath.brasksoft.test
DRUATH_SEAL=seal_7d2e069d
DRUATH_STANDBY_TEAM=olieth

Ticket: Staging env misconfigured for Siftgate bloom filter

The bloom layer in front of the Pellet KV store is rejecting all lookups in staging because the env file was copied from the dev template without credentials. False-positive tuning values are fine; only the auth line is missing. To unblock the weekly demo, the Pellet admission secret must be set on the following line.

env line for yaguf-fajop: LEDGER_TOKEN13=fb08984397349

Handover note — Crumbwheel order cutoffs.

Welcome aboard. The bakery cutoff rule in Crumbwheel closes same-day orders at 14:00 local to each storefront, not UTC — this has bitten us twice. Holiday overrides live in the calendar service and take precedence silently, so always check there first when a cutoff looks wrong. To unlock the calendar service's admin console after a restart, enter the recovery passphrase below.

vault phrase of bagap-bahaf = silion-pelox-sorox-casdor-quenwyn-fraax-eliox-praael-kelion-quenvan-kasox-rusael-norius-belvan

## Local Setup

Welcome aboard! Shrinkly is our little CLI for batch-resizing images before they hit the Pixelbarn asset store. Clone the repo, run `make bootstrap`, and you're most of the way there. You'll need Go 1.22+ and libvips installed locally. Shrinkly logs resize jobs to a small Postgres instance, so you'll need to point it at one. Use the following connection string for local dev.

replica DSN, yahaf-yagaf: mongodb://tamath_svc:a2netSk3RZMuTj@db-d084.novacsoft.internal:5432/ralmir